A mashup of "maybe" and "perhaps." Can be used in a rush, or just for shits and giggles.
Alternatives can include, but are not limited to; maybehaps, prolly, mayhap.

Maybe and perhaps.
You say it when you don’t want to give a straight answer, or use it as a cooler way of saying “maybe, maybe not”.

Composed of both words 'maybe' and 'Perhaps'. It is more posh than either, usually used in a question and only when it sounds right.
